Early Land Acquisition in Augusta County, VA

James Gillespie, Jr. acquired land from his father, James Gillespie, Sr., in his will.


Disposition of Land from Chalkley's:


  • Page 37.--22d August, 1787. James Gillispie and Elizabeth to Michael Coynart, of Cumberland County, Pennsylvania.
